In operations since 1980, we are a family-owned vertically integrated full-service growing, labor, and harvesting company operating in Mexico and the USA. We provide services to well-known growers and shippers who provide fruits and vegetables to the nation's leading grocery and food service users. We are proud to have gained the reputation of “Setting the Standard” in our respective industries. Our growing operations in Baja California, Harvest Tek de Mexico (HTMX), provides conventional and organic agriculture products that meet modern LGMA food safety standards. Our ownership consists of founders, Steve and Brenda Scaroni, and their two sons Matt and David Scaroni. Together they are well known in the industry for their hands-on leadership style. The Production Growing Manager will perform vital functions of the operation in a manner that is economically successful, strategically oriented, technically innovative and safely executed. The manager will be responsible for all aspects of the production and growing operations, managing the ground preparation and planning process as well as executing the day to day harvest and post-harvest of the approximately 4,000 acres of leafy greens and vegetables.
